com.vaadin.flow.server.connect.
Class VaadinConnectControllerConfiguration
- java.lang.Object
-
- com.vaadin.flow.server.connect.VaadinConnectControllerConfiguration
-
public class VaadinConnectControllerConfiguration extends Object
A configuration class for customizing the
VaadinConnectController
class.
-
-
Constructor Summary
Constructors Constructor and Description VaadinConnectControllerConfiguration(VaadinEndpointProperties vaadinEndpointProperties)
Initializes the endpoint configuration.
-
Method Summary
All Methods Modifier and Type Method and Description VaadinConnectAccessChecker
accessChecker()
Registers a default
VaadinConnectAccessChecker
bean instance.EndpointNameChecker
endpointNameChecker()
Registers an endpoint name checker responsible for validating the endpoint names.
ExplicitNullableTypeChecker
typeChecker()
Registers a
ExplicitNullableTypeChecker
bean instance.WebMvcRegistrations
webMvcRegistrationsHandlerMapping()
Registers
VaadinConnectController
to useVaadinEndpointProperties.getVaadinEndpointPrefix()
as a prefix for all Vaadin endpoints.
-
-
-
Constructor Detail
-
VaadinConnectControllerConfiguration
public VaadinConnectControllerConfiguration(VaadinEndpointProperties vaadinEndpointProperties)
Initializes the endpoint configuration.
Parameters:
vaadinEndpointProperties
- Vaadin ednpoint properties
-
-
Method Detail
-
webMvcRegistrationsHandlerMapping
public WebMvcRegistrations webMvcRegistrationsHandlerMapping()
Registers
VaadinConnectController
to useVaadinEndpointProperties.getVaadinEndpointPrefix()
as a prefix for all Vaadin endpoints.Returns:
updated configuration for
VaadinConnectController
-
endpointNameChecker
public EndpointNameChecker endpointNameChecker()
Registers an endpoint name checker responsible for validating the endpoint names.
Returns:
the endpoint name checker
-
accessChecker
public VaadinConnectAccessChecker accessChecker()
Registers a default
VaadinConnectAccessChecker
bean instance.Returns:
the default Vaadin endpoint access checker bean
-
typeChecker
public ExplicitNullableTypeChecker typeChecker()
Registers a
ExplicitNullableTypeChecker
bean instance.Returns:
the explicit nullable type checker
-
-